logo

Output 81b05907e8315bec241ba233fef2845b0941c9166327a65da00b277abd736dfd:0

value
30487082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816a4b25a4b5b787593ce6c7b528a4de6538a312 OP_EQUAL
address
3DVJRhFKtCVavXFm7K6YFG1HACq9bK1SPa
transaction
81b05907e8315bec241ba233fef2845b0941c9166327a65da00b277abd736dfd